TIEMCO LURES
Mukkuri 52F 005

The lively action unique to floating lures entices the elusive trout.

Featuring an easy-casting weight configuration suitable for bait tackle, this lure excels in achieving impressive distances during full casts with spinning gear, defying expectations for a floating minnow.
With a focus on a lively rolling action during steady retrieves and twitching, this lure exhibits agile movements. True to its floating minnow nature, it responds well to delicate rod work. Its versatility spans from a slow, natural lure presentation to quick reaction targeting, allowing anglers to precisely control its actions.
Effective not only for energetic early-season trout but also during low-water periods in shallow areas or when trout are actively aware of falling terrestrial insects on the water's surface or underwater. It proves particularly effective when drifting parallel to rocky shores or slow-flowing beneath overhanging vegetation. Experiment with various techniques, such as a long drift along the shoreline or casting beneath trees.
Furthermore, it expands its appeal to deeper pools and drop-offs, enticing trout that follow up from the depths. Drifting after a stop or incorporating subtle twitches after a pause widens the range of enticing maneuvers available to anglers. 52mm, 3.4g class, Floating.
